Kumkum Bhagya: Ektaa Kapoor has delivered several daily soaps with distinct family drama, among them is Kumkum Bhagya. It is one of the long-running and most successful shows on Zee TV, since its first premiere in 2014. The current show featuring Pranali Rathod, Namik Paul and Akshay Bindra in lead roles, is reportedly going off air soon due to a drop in TRP ratings. After ruling the small screen for over a decade, Kumkum Bhagya may end with the final episode in September.

Kumkum Bhagya To Go Off Air

This longest-running show began with Pragya (Sriti Jha) and Abhishek (Shabir Ahluwalia) as the main faces of the story. Later, Mugdha Chaphekar as Prachi and Krishna Kaul as Ranbir took over the lead roles, followed by Rachi Sharma as Poorvi and Abrar Qazi as Rajvansh, who continued the legacy and captivated the audiences. Now, the fourth generation storyline featuring the chemistry between Pranali Rathore and Namik Paul has also been appreciated by viewers. However, the show has struggled to secure a spot in the TRP ratings. After spanning four generations, reports suggestthat Ektaa Kapoor's Kumkum Bhagya may come to an end soon.

As per a source quoted by IWM Buzz informed, "Kumkum Bhagya, which presently has Pranali Rathod, Namik Paul and Akshay Bindra as the fourth-generation leads in the show, will soon go off air. The decision, apparently, has been made to end the long-running show. The show has been struggling with a drop in TRPs for some time now.”

As Zee channel has recently introduced a slate of new TV shows, including Tumm Se Tumm Tak, Vasudha and Jaane Anjaane Hum Mile, which have been well received by viewers since their debut on television. As per media reports, Kumkum Bhagya will be replaced by a new family drama titled Ganga Mai Ki Betiyaan, produced by Ravie Dubey and Sargun Mehta under their banner, Dreamiyata Entertainment.
